Lighting plays a crucial role in our daily lives, whether it be for functional or aesthetic purposes. One type of light bulb that has gained popularity in recent years is the 4 pin light bulb. Also known as a compact fluorescent lamp (CFL), this versatile lighting solution offers numerous benefits and applications across various settings.
One significant advantage of the 4 pin light bulb is its energy efficiency. CFLs are designed to consume significantly less energy compared to traditional incandescent bulbs, making them an eco-friendly choice. These bulbs utilize a small amount of electricity while producing the same amount of light, resulting in lower energy bills and reduced environmental impact. This energy efficiency also means a longer lifespan, on average, compared to other lighting options.
